PCI-1710 Datasheet, PDF (1/2 Pages) Advantech Co., Ltd. – 100 kS/s, 12-bit, 16-ch PCI Multifunction Card
PCI-1710/L
100 kS/s, 12-bit, 16-ch PCI
Multifunction Card
PCI-1710HG/HGL 100 kS/s, 12-bit, 16-ch PCI
Multifunction Card with High Gain
Features
 16-ch single-ended or 8-ch differential or a combination of analog input
 12-bit A/D converter, with up to 100 kHz sampling rate
 Programmable gain
 Automatic channel/gain scanning
 Onboard FIFO memory (4,096 samples)
 Two 12-bit analog output channels (PCI-1710/1710HG only)
 16-ch digital input and 16-ch digital output
 Onboard programmable counter
 BoardID™ switch
RoHS
COMPLIANT
2002/95/EC
Introduction
The PCI-1710 Series are multifunction cards for the PCI bus. Their advanced circuit design provides higher quality and more functions, including the five most desired measurement
and control functions: 12-bit A/D conversion, D/A conversion, digital input, digital output, and counter/timer.

Digital Input
 Channels
 Compatibility
 Input Voltage
16
5 V/TTL
Logic 0: 0.8 V max.
Logic 1: 2.0 V min.
Digital Output
 Channels
 Compatibility
 Output Voltage
 Output Capability
16
5 V/TTL
Logic 0: 0.4 V max.
Logic 1: 2.4 V min.
Sink: 8.0 mA @ 0.8 V
Source: -0.4 mA @ 2.0 V
Pacer/Counter
 Channels
 Resolution
 Compatibility
 Max. Input Frequency
1
16 bits
5 V/TTL
1 MHz
